ads谐波平衡法仿真设计_第1页
ads谐波平衡法仿真设计_第2页
ads谐波平衡法仿真设计_第3页
ads谐波平衡法仿真设计_第4页
ads谐波平衡法仿真设计_第5页
已阅读5页,还剩2页未读 继续免费阅读

付费下载

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、谐波平衡法仿真设计一、摘要谐波平衡法仿真是研究非线性电路的非线性特性和系统失真的频域仿真分析法。一般适合模拟射频微波电路仿真。 首先介绍谐波平衡法仿真基本原理及相关控件使用情况,然后利用实例详细介绍谐波平衡仿真法的一般相关操作及注意事项。在射频电路设计中,通常需要得到射频电路的稳态响应。如果采用传统的SPICE模拟器对射频电路进行仿真,通常需要经 过很长的瞬态模拟时间电路的响应才会稳定。对于射频电路,可以采用特殊的仿真技术在较短的时间内获得稳态响应,谐波平衡法就是其中之一。二、正文2.1实验综述谐波平衡仿真是非线性系统分析最常用的分析方法,用于仿真非线性电路中的噪声、增益压缩、谐波失真、振荡器

2、寄生、相噪和互调产物,它要比 SPICE 仿真器快得多,可以用来对混频器、振荡器、放大器等进行仿真分析。对放大器 而言,采用谐波平衡法分析的目的就是进行大信号的非线性模拟。(1) 确定电流或电压的频谱成分;(2) 计算参数,如:三阶截取点,总谐波失真及交调失真分量;(3) 执行电源放大器负载激励回路分析;(4) 执行非线性噪声分析。2.2实验过程(实验步骤、记录、数据、分析)2.2.1构建电路(1) 打开上一章的仿真原理图s_final。(2) 用一个新名称HB_basic保存原理图,删除所有仿真测量组件及输入端口 (Term)。(3) 在“source_Freq Domain”元件面板歹U表

3、中选择 P_1 Tone控件,插入输入 端;(4) 在图中标注 Vin, Vout, VC和VB四个节点;(5) 修改P_1Tone源参数,同时命名为 RF_source,如图2. 1所示:Freq=1.9 GHzZ=50 OhmP= dbmtow (-40)Num=1P_1ToneHRFsource4Num=l Z=5QOhm P»dbmtow(-40) Freq=1.9GHz 图2.1 RF源设置2.2.2设置仿真参数(1) 选择“Simulation-HB ”类元件面板,在原理图上放置谐波平衡仿真控制器, 如图2.2所示;(2) 修改参数Freql=1.9GHz 基波频率为 1

4、.9GHz Order1=3谐波次数为3HARMONIC BALANCE IHarmonicSalanoeH01Freq1=19GHz Onder1=3图2.2谐波平衡仿真控制器2.2.3设定测量方程式(1) 在“Simulation-HB ”元件面板歹0表中选择测量方程控件,放置到原理图中。双击测量方程控件,输入 dbm_out=dBm(Vout1)方程,如图2.3所示。陲MeasEqnMeasl dbm_out=dBm(Vout1)图2.3测量方程控件设置方括号1中的数字指的是在分析中计算频率的索引值。当 Order=3时,索 引值表示为:index0是直流,indexl 是1900MHz

5、 index2是二次谐波即 3800MHz index3是指三次谐波。因此,方程式表示以 dBm表示的1900MHzW 号的输出功率。完整电路图:HARMONIC BALANCEHarmonkSalanceHB1Or 顿 1F3VtK 匕DCJSKA兰Vdc=Vbfas T圜儒VNasvRbR=5kOiiTi 'hfeasl dyiLPgVoiCq)VtoL4L=1&3nH 112 Ctrni JtYYXCClBO pF止, L5L1 j LFSOnH ?R=L2L=12OnHAPjTtne RFkmfm NjitfI Z=50Oto P=«rtcwt-4D) Ftw

6、I.SGHeVBVCHF c £2早网OdOpFQ1DelW半 CX122pFVout1=27.1 UH R6GimItorni TenrtZHjm=2 Z=30 0hm图2.4 HB_basic 电路原理图(2) 进行仿真,没有任何警告和错误信息,仿真通过;(3) 改变谐波平衡控制器参数 Freq1=1800MHz。再次仿真,出现错误信息,原因是源的频率(1900MHZ与HB1频率(1800MHZ相差100MHz 故源频率与 控制器频率一定保持一致2.2.4仿真结果输出(1) 在数据显示窗口,插入 Vout矩形图,得到输出信号的频谱;(2) 在基频上插入Marker,如图2.5所示

7、。放大器在1.9GHz频率点的输出功率为-4.876dBm ;(3) 在数据显示闵口中插入数据表,并使数据列表中显示“ dbm_out ,可以得 到 输出信号的功率值,如图2.6所示。dbm out-4.876图2.6输出信号的功率值(4) 在数据左侧窗口单击工具栏,插入 Vin和Vout两个时域信号的数据轨迹。 ts (时间序歹0)函数在谐波平衡法中将结果转换到时域。插入两个Marker点,如图2.7所示,会发现Vin和Vout在同一个时刻输出信号相位基本一致(非反 相)。V mV mV stime, nsec图2.8 VB和VC信号的时域波形图2.7输入和输出信号的时域波形(5) 在轨迹图

8、中直接把 Vout改为VC, Vin改为VB来编辑y轴标识,如图2.8 所示。(6) 观察m4和m5点,信号相位相反。通过和图对比,这说明匹配网络对相位有 着很大的影响。5 4 3 2 10 0 002 10 9 88 8 8 7 7 VZ,-LUvmJ>4am4m4 me=400 05=/_s(VC)=4128 V、一/k /-IrIr112.2.5函数和索引的使用(1) 利用列表工具,显示Mix及Vout的值,如图2.9所示。在谐波仿真运行时 数据组中就会产生一个 Mix索引值。freqMixVout0.0000 Hz00.000 / 0.0001.900 GHz10.180 / -

9、14.1993.800 GHz20.001 /-170.9395.700 GHz31.963E-5 / 46.135图2.9 Mix 和Vout数据表(2) 通过双击歹U表,进入“Plot Traces & Attributes ”对话框。点击把竺竺亶二 按钮。在“ Enter any expression ”栏中输入dBm(Vin),然后单击“ OK得到 如图2.10所示:freqMixVoutdBm(Vin)0.0000 卜Hz00.000 / 0.000<invali(1.900 GHz10.180 / -14.199-40.213.800 GHz20.001 / -170

10、.939-82.945.700 GHz31.963E-5 / 46.135-111.1(43图2.10更新的数据表(3) 在Vin自变量中键入索引值1来编辑dBm(Vin)数据,如图2.11所示。得到在索 引频率为1时( 1900MHZ的Vin值为-40.214dBm。freqMixVoutdBm(Vin1)0.0000 Hz00.000 / 0.00)0-40.2141.900 GHz10.180 / -14.1993.800 GHz20.001 / -170.9395.700 GHz31.963E-5 / 46.135图2.11参数数据表(4) 将光标插入dBm(Vin1)表达式并键入逗号

11、“,”和50, dBm函数中第二个自变量是Zin,缺省值50Q,因此输出没有改变,如图2.12所示:freqMixVoutdBm(Vin1,50)0.0000 Hz00.000 / 0.000-40.2141.900 GHz10.180 / -14.1.3.800 GHz20.001 / -170.5.700 GHz31.963E-5 / 46.图2.12参数数据表2.2.6 输入功率和 Zin。(1)在HB_basic设计中,从“Probe Compenents'元件控制面板中调出电流指示器 控件(current probe ),重命名为I_in,插入到原理图中,如图 2.13所示:

12、I ProbeP_1Tone F?F_source Num=1 Z=5O Ohm P=dxntow(-40) Freq=1.9GHz图2.13电流指示器(2)重新仿真。仿真结束后,在数据显示窗口利用方程计算平均传输功率,如图2.14所示P_del_dbm=10*log(0.5*real(Vin1*conj(I_in.i1)+30图2.14插入方程(3) 如图2.15所示,写另一个方程计算Zin。然后,将插入Z_in参数方程列表,如图2.16所示。注意到复数阻抗并不是 50,而是47.619 QEq(Z_in=Vin/I_in.i图2.15输入阻抗方程freqZ_in0.0000 Hz<i

13、nvalid>1.900 GHz47.619 / 0.6863.800 GHz50.000 / -180.0005.700 GHz50.000 / -180.000图2.16输入阻抗值(4) 插入列表,显示 dBm(Vout1)、dBm(Vin1 , Z_in)和 P_del_dBm数据, 如图2.17所示:dBm(Vout1)dBm(Vin1,Z_in1P_del_dbm-4.876i-40.003-40.003三、总结在频域中描述如三极管、二极管等非线性器件是非常困难的,然而,在时域中这些非线性元件很容易得到其非线性模型。因此,在谐波平衡仿真器中,非线 性系统用时域描述,用频率描述线性系统,谐波平衡分析法将时域和频域通过 FFT结合起来,它将电路状态变量近似写成傅立叶级数展开的形式,通常展开项 必须取得足够大,以保证高次谐波对于模拟结果的影响可以忽略不计。谐波平衡法在目前的商用RF软件中得到了

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论